What puppies continue practicing

Practical foundations, not a finished puppy fantasy.

Extended Preschool is not a promise of a perfectly trained puppy. It is a stronger foundation: more practice, more structure, and a more informed handoff before puppy pickup.

  • Crate routines, quiet time, and waiting to be released.
  • Potty rhythm support and clean-space habits.
  • Leash, carrier, and car foundations appropriate for the puppy's age.
  • Grooming table practice, nails, brushing, baths, and body handling.
  • Food manners, resource guarding prevention, and calm behavior reinforcement.
  • Safe outings, sounds, surfaces, problem-solving, and confidence work.
  • Guidance for continuing the work at home.
